The Clinical Foundation of Integrative Specialists
Many patients wonder, Is an integrative medicine specialist a licensed doctor? Yes, many integrative medicine specialists are licensed medical doctors (MDs) or doctors of osteopathic medicine (DOs) who have undergone rigorous clinical training. Beyond their foundational medical licenses, these physicians may pursue board certification through organizations like the American Board of Integrative Medicine (ABOIM), which validates their mastery of core competencies in whole-person, evidence-based care. This specialty requires practitioners to combine conventional medical practices with complementary, mind-body, and lifestyle-focused modalities to support the body’s innate healing.
Because integrative medicine remains an evolving field, it is important to understand that board certification signifies a physician’s commitment to high ethical standards and advanced expertise. Practical Mindfulness Techniques for Daily Restoration
Mindfulness is defined as the practice of maintaining moment-to-moment awareness of your experience without judgment APA. Unlike simply trying to clear your head, this approach involves training your attention to stay anchored in the present, which helps counteract the reactive, automatic patterns that often fuel chronic stress UCLA Health.
What are the core components and benefits of a mindfulness practice?
Mindfulness serves as a bridge between your mental state and physical well-being. By integrating consistent practice into your routine, you can foster benefits such as improved stress management, enhanced emotional resilience, and clearer cognitive function NIH. Beyond mental clarity, these habits support your body by regulating your nervous system and lowering systemic stress markers that contribute to fatigue University of Utah.
Body Scans. This technique involves systematically shifting your attention through different parts of the body to notice areas of tension or discomfort without trying to change them. It cultivates presence and body awareness.
S.T.O.P. Method. A practical tool for daily life: Stop what you are doing, Take a breath, Observe your thoughts and physical sensations, and Proceed with more intentionality.
Mindful Breathing. Focusing your full attention on the sensation of air entering and leaving the body helps anchor your awareness, providing a necessary break for the nervous system during high-stress moments.
Think of mindfulness as a mental muscle that requires consistent training to strengthen. Even short, one-to-two-minute sessions UCLA Health can provide noticeable shifts in how you handle daily challenges. Navigating Insurance Coverage for Integrative Care
Insurance coverage for integrative medicine is complex and varies significantly by provider and individual plan, making it essential to contact your carrier directly to verify benefits. While there is a growing trend toward covering complementary services, particularly acupuncture, chiropractic care, and certain physical therapies, coverage is rarely universal and often depends on whether a treatment is deemed medically necessary. Insurers frequently require these services to be ordered by a licensed medical or osteopathic doctor to qualify for reimbursement.
Some plans may only offer negotiated discounts for specific providers rather than full coverage, requiring you to pay the remaining balance out-of-pocket. - Contact your insurance carrier using the member services number on your card to ask about specific coverage for complementary and alternative medicine.
- Verify if your plan requires a referral from a primary care physician to ensure services like acupuncture or clinical nutrition are eligible for reimbursement.
- Ask if your chosen provider is in-network or if your plan covers out-of-network benefits, which often carry different deductible requirements.
- Document all interactions, including the names of representatives and reference numbers for coverage inquiries, to support your billing claims.
